- Pawnshop: Built on Family and Skateboarding
For as long as Donovon Piscopo can remember, he and his father, Anthony, have been skateboarding. Raised in Covina, California, Donovon grew up in a scene that wasn't started by his father but has been 100-percent cultivated by him. Their family business, Pawnshop, has been around for 16 years, but ...

- Super Skate Posse Giveback 34: New Brunswick, New Jersey
SSP & The City Of New Brunswick‘s 5th annual giveback, CIRQUE DU SKATE, block party was another great day for the city and New Jersey! In the last five years over 500 skateboards have put on the streets in New Brunswick alone! "Thanks to Middlesex County Culture & Arts Department, NJ ...
